Yttersia - Season 1

Season 1

Episodes

Episode 1
The proximity to the ocean means that fishing is the most important livelihood. Trond Ludvigsen wanted to be a skipper when he was young, but poor hearing put an end to that. He is a fisherman, but the future is uncertain. Laila Hansen will set up a skreimøljekalas and finds the delicacies where you least expect them to be.

Episode 2
Here, Icelanders Kristin and Kristjon have invented a type of snack, made from fish. They must keep the recipe a secret so that they are not outcompeted by others in the industry. 19-year-old Kristian's big dream is to become a fisherman, and he moves to Sommarøya to get a short distance to the fishing boats.

Episode 3
Laila and her friends are going to organize one of their popular møljekalas for the village's pensioners. They spend the whole day preparing, and the delicacy must not become chewy. Little fish is delivered to Lorentzen's fish farm, suddenly it is almost a black sea for the fishermen.

Episode 4
Ingvard Lorentzen was only 20 years old when he took over the fish farm that has been in the family for four generations. During the scree season, the working days are often so long that he does not make it home, but has to spend the night at the mill. Trond Ludvigsen realizes that he has to leave the fishing profession, because a hearing loss bothers him too much.

Episode 5
Kristian's dream of becoming a fisherman may come to naught. It is difficult to get a job on the fishing boats. Kristin and Kristjon have to leave the house they have rented, and the solution is to buy their own house. But it is far from move-in ready. Laila and her friends must both serve and entertain 100 guests from the Rescue Society.

Episode 6
A party is arranged at the fish farm, despite the fact that fishing has not brought much income this year. The Lorentzen mill is celebrating 120 years, and Ingvard and his partners are beating the big drum. Here you will party and dance in the bright summer night.
